Yorkshire: 2016 National Conference for Rural Catholics

The 2016 National Conference for Rural Catholics takes place from 15-17 February In the very comfortable Old Lodge Hotel, Malton, North Yorkshire. This will be the 12th annual conference.

The Bishop of Hexham & Newcastle, Rt Rev Seamus Cunningham, and the Bishop of Middlesbrough, RT Rev Terry Drainey, are expected.

Highlights from the programme include an introduction to the equine world of North Yorkshire; talks on 'View from the Stable Door' and 'Racing Welfare' plus visits to an injured jockeys' rehabilitation centre and an equine veterinary practice; other talks on 'Ecology and Laudato Si, the current work of the ecumenical Arthur Rank Centre in Warwickshire, the NFU on 'Rural Crime', and Gareth Barlow a well-known farmer and broadcaster on 'Communicating Agriculture'. Bookings are coming in from across the country.
